Lorelei Shannon is a horror and dark fantasy writer, sculptor, and computer game designer. She is the author of numerous short stories, novels, and a game that was banned from three countries and Sears stores everywhere.
Born in the Arizona desert, Lorelei learned to walk holding on to the tail of a coyote. She was a strange, fey child who kept to herself, and could often be found feeding flies to a big praying mantis in her mother's rose garden.
Lorelei now lives in the woods outside Seattle with her beloved husband, two beautiful sons, a thundering horde of dogs and cats, and a really scary goldfish. Her interests include reading, gothabilly and psychobilly music, cultivating carnivorous plants, getting tattoos, the Rain City Hearse Club, and her 1947 Cadillac hearse, Annabel Lee.
